Key Points

Positve
  • Ocular Therapeutix Inc (OCUL) has reached a key enrollment milestone in their SO1 trial, which is expected to accelerate enrollment in the SOLAR trial.
  • The company has seen strong demand for participation in their clinical studies, indicating high interest from both patients and physicians.
  • OCUL's financial position is strong, with approximately $427 million in cash and cash equivalents, providing a runway into 2028.
  • The company has a remarkable commercial team achieving excellent results with Dextenza, which strengthens their market presence.
  • OCUL's trials have shown promising results, with no vision-threatening complications observed in certain patient groups, highlighting the potential efficacy of their treatments.
Negative
  • There is uncertainty regarding the regulatory submission process, as both SO1 and SOLAR studies need to be completed for approval.
  • The company is still in the early stages of discussing pricing strategies for their potential new products.
  • OCUL faces challenges in ensuring seamless transitions between trials to maintain enrollment momentum.
  • The company has not yet provided detailed guidance on their discussions with regulatory agencies outside the US.
  • There is a need to balance focus between ongoing trials and potential new opportunities in diabetic retinopathy and diabetic macular edema.
